Can I grow any flowers indoors?
Fortunately, you can enjoy the beauty of flowering plants all year long, by creating an indoor flower garden. All you need are a few pots or containers, an aerated planting mixture and some indoor-friendly plant species.

Can a houseplant live forever?
Most botanists agree there are no predetermined lifespans of indoor plants. Theoretically, in the absence of adversity, most houseplants can live forever. That is, until we kill them. Some plants lend themselves better to indoor conditions than others, and their growing habits contribute to long lives.
What is the easiest indoor plant to take care of?
Probably the easiest indoor plant to take care of is the sanseveria, often called mother-in-law’s tongue or snake plant. It will thrive in almost any amount of light indoors, and requires very little water. It does, however, require some.
What is the best tree to grow indoors?
Pick Meyer lemon trees for growing indoors. Meyer lemon trees are the best and most adaptable tree for growing inside. They produce plenty of small or medium fruits and their maintenance level is more friendly for beginners. Pink variegated lemon trees also grow well indoors and are beginner-friendly.
What are the easiest vegetables to grow indoors?
Lettuce is one of the easiest and fastest vegetables to grow indoors. It is typically ready to harvest three to four weeks after planting, and continues to grow, producing every two weeks after. Leaf lettuces, such as green leaf, spinach, cress, arugula, Swiss chard and curly endive, grow best indoors.
